Sound recording: can record my voice once


Aspire 5100
Elive-Gem
Audio device: ATI Technologies Inc SB450 HDA Audio (rev 01)

Hi,
after I got crazy trying to make working the alsa support for my Hda_intel( I could hear sound, hear my Micro but not record my voice) I switched to Oss system to record my voice. It works but just once and for few seconds. I need to restart the computer to record again.

Could you run this script and post the link? I'd like to see your alsa configuration. It is possible that your system simply hasn't been added to the alsa driver yet. It's hard for us developers to keep up.

The Intel HD Audio is more of a bus specification than an actual device. On that bus, there is usually a sound chip, and in laptops, a modem (soft modem). There are currently 5 major manufacturers of sound chips for this bus, and each manufacturer has multiple chips. To make it even more confusing, each system manufacturer (Acer in your case) can add the same chip to all of their different motherboards, and each board will require a different configuration. For example, Intel released 20 motherboards with the exact same audio chip and the exact same configuration, but each has a different identification (pci subsystem ID). More work for us.
